Frequently Asked Questions

How is a 3D printed chassis installed on a Heritage Rough Rider revolver?

The 3D printed chassis typically consists of two main pieces that slide over the 16-inch barrel and are secured with screws. A handguard piece then holds these two sections together. An AR-15 stock can be attached via a 3D printed buffer tube adapter.

What are the safety considerations when shooting a modified Heritage Rough Rider?

The cylinder gap releases hot gases and shrapnel, which can cause burns. It's recommended to wear long sleeves and eye protection. Some 3D printed chassis designs include guards for the cylinder gap, or you can print them separately.

Where can I find 3D printable files for a Heritage Rough Rider chassis?

Files for the 3D printed chassis, including the front end, are available from YouTuber Boolean Shooting Sports. The buffer tube attachment for an AR-15 stock was found on Thingiverse.

What are the typical specifications of a Heritage Rough Rider revolver?

The Heritage Rough Rider is typically a single-action, six-shot revolver chambered in .22 Long Rifle. It features a manual safety and can be found with various barrel lengths, including the 16-inch barrel discussed in this modification.
